Як налаштувати Google Analytics на вашому веб-сайті — покроковий посібник


Рекомендація: Налаштуйте властивість GA4 та встановіть глобальний тег сайту (gtag.js) на кожній сторінці, щоб почати збирати дані. Використовуйте готовий, керований процес та одне вікно для копіювання та вставки коду.
З акаунта Google Analytics використовуйте випадаючий список для вибору Web як типу потоку даних. Оберіть унікальну, описову назву для властивості та переконайтеся, що параметр вимірювання є GA4. Це допомагає організовувати дані за вимірами, такими як page_title, page_location та категорія пристрою. Чисте налаштування полегшує аналіз.
Ви можете встановити тег вручну в коді сайту або використовувати Google Tag Manager для автоматизованого розгортання. Якщо йдете вручну, вставте фрагмент безпосередньо в тег head на кожній сторінці. У GTM створіть новий тег конфігурації GA4 та опублікуйте. Якщо ви спокушені змінити ID пізніше, уникайте зміни ID вимірювання.
Двічі перевірте ID вимірювання у вашому тегу проти того, що показано в інтерфейсі GA4. Стежте за помилками в ID та назві властивості; маленька помилка може зупинити появу даних. У вікні налаштування перевірте, що потоки даних активні та що ви бачите недавній знак активності в Real Time. Якщо щось виглядає не так, зупиніться та перевірте ще раз.
Налаштуйте базові події та параметри для захоплення дій, таких як page_view, scroll та кліки. Використовуйте параметри, як event_name та page_location, для захоплення контексту. У розділі Measurements увімкніть розширене вимірювання, щоб автоматично збирати стандартні події без додавання коду. Переконайтеся, що ви налаштували ці події, щоб вони відображали ваші цілі та аудиторію.
Перевірте збір даних після встановлення, відвідавши сторінку та перевіривши звіт Real-Time. Якщо ви бачите дані, розширте моніторинг на повний день, щоб підтвердити тенденції та скоригувати цілі. Якщо ви керуєте кількома сайтами, повторно використовуйте ту саму властивість GA4 з унікальними потоками даних, щоб ви могли порівнювати продуктивність без створення окремих акаунтів.
Якщо вам потрібна допомога, зверніться до команди або надійного партнера з аналітики. Система покаже ключові виміри, такі як місто, пристрій та джерело, допомагаючи оптимізувати кампанії та контент.
Наступні кроки: налаштуйте конверсії та визначте цілі, потім перегляньте налаштування адміну та двічі перевірте, що дані надходять до GA4 перед внесенням змін. Моніторте дані у спеціальному вікні та коригуйте за потреби, щоб тримати інсайти свіжими.
Метод 1: Налаштування GA4 з Google Tag Manager
Встановіть GA4 через Google Tag Manager, щоб мігрувати по вашій цифровій присутності, швидко централізувати теги та підтримувати шаблони, використані у вашій загальній архітектурі сайту.
Переконайтеся, що GTM встановлено на кожній сторінці. Якщо ні, вставте фрагмент контейнера в загальний шаблон сайту, щоб він завантажувався по пристроях та охоплював усі сторінки.
У GTM створіть тег Конфігурація GA4 за допомогою вбудованих шаблонів. Введіть ваш ID вимірювання та увімкніть стандартний page_view, щоб почати відстежувати відвідування по секціях та пристроях.
Встановіть тригери: All Pages для тегу конфігурації. Додайте теги подій GA4 для ключових взаємодій, таких як кліки на посилання "site-nav__linkmain", подання форм та відтворення відео. Використовуйте точні тригери, щоб дані надсилалися до GA4 з чистими параметрами.
Зберігайте єдине джерело істини, мапуючи події до таблиці або файлу та узгоджуючи їх з чотирма поширеними випадками: page_view, click, form_submit та video_start. Це допомагає будь-якому члену команди досліджувати події та тримати зміни скоординованими по секціях.
Тестування: увімкніть GTM Preview, щоб перевірити, що теги спрацьовують перед публікацією. Перевірте звіти Real-time в GA4 після публікації, щоб підтвердити, що треки з'являються у вашому потоці даних. Якщо виникають проблеми, перегляньте dataLayer та загальні налаштування, щоб забезпечити, що події надіслані з очікуваними параметрами.
Порада з міграції: якщо ви мігруєте з іншого інструменту аналітики, експортуйте ключові події з тієї системи, зіставте їх з подіями GA4 у ваших шаблонах та задокументуйте зіставлення в пості або гайді. Зберігайте шаблони та їхні зіставлення в спільній папці, щоб власники залишалися в курсі змін.
Постійно: підтверджуйте охоплення по пристроях та використовуйте чотири секції робочого простору GTM – Tags, Triggers, Variables та Data Layer – щоб тримати зміни організованими та уникати конфліктів на зайнятих сайтах. Після кожного оновлення закрийте редактор та пере-публікуйте, коли готові.
Перевірте передумови: Google Account, GTM Container та GA4 Property
Створіть акаунт Google, якщо у вас його немає, потім увійдіть та створіть контейнер GTM для вашого сайту (Web) та властивість GA4 в такому порядку. Ця трійка – Google Account, контейнер GTM, властивість GA4 – надає іншу основу для захоплення сигналів та контролю тегів без торкання коду сайту. Це налаштування працює по різних сайтах, включаючи woocommerce магазини, та закладає солідну базу для відстеження, пов'язаного з продуктами.
У GTM створіть контейнер з основною назвою та типом Web, потім встановіть фрагмент контейнера на ваш сайт. Це дозволяє тегам спрацьовувати негайно. Використовуйте поширений підхід: налаштуйте тег Page View, тригер menu_click та тег Конфігурація GA4. Для сайтів woocommerce налаштуйте події product_view та add_to_cart для захоплення.
У GA4 створіть потік даних для вашого веб-сайту та скопіюйте measurement_id до тегу Конфігурація GA4 у GTM. Це налаштування забезпечує, що події захоплюються та можуть бути розширені кастомними подіями пізніше. Реалізація макросу для параметрів подій, як label та product, допомагає підтримувати послідовність по одиницях та цьому моменту взаємодії.
Тестуйте в режимі GTM Preview, щоб забезпечити, що події спрацьовують та захоплюються правильно в GA4, потім використовуйте DebugView для підтвердження. Якщо налагодження виявляє прогалини, перевірте розміщення встановлення та дозволи в акаунті GTM; пройдіться через кроки налагодження та підготуйтеся до майбутніх оновлень у стандартах тегування. Зберігайте структурований підсумок того, що ви перевірили.
Встановіть політики збереження даних та задовольніть вимоги конфіденційності. У GA4 та GTM створіть кілька міток, щоб відрізняти поширені події (page_view, click, purchase) та тримати довжину звітів керованою. Це допомагає довгостроковому збереженню та плавнішій звітності.
Далі, кастомізуйте додаткові події для різних сторінок продуктів та кроків оформлення, особливо для woocommerce магазинів. Використовуйте крок встановлення в GTM, щоб додати кастомну подію, як macro_checkout_complete або woocommerce_order_completed, для уточнення ваших даних. Зберігайте стислий підсумок того, що ви реалізували, та перегляньте налаштування збереження та шляхи конверсій, щоб покращити ваш підхід до звітності на основі макросів. Більше порад приходить від практичного налагодження та тестування, тож ви можете повернутися з покращеннями в наступний момент.
Створіть властивість GA4 та потік даних

Створіть властивість GA4, потім додайте потік даних Web, щоб почати отримувати інсайти негайно. У Google Analytics перейдіть до Admin, клацніть Create Property та заповніть загальні деталі: назва властивості, часовий пояс та валюта. Після підтвердження GA4 встановлює основну рамку вимірювання, і ви можете скоригувати загальні налаштування під ваші потреби. Цей крок встановлює обсяг збору даних та починає шлях для майбутньої звітності.
Налаштуйте потік даних Web: оберіть Web, введіть URL сайту, назву потоку та увімкніть розширене вимірювання, щоб захоплювати перегляди сторінок, прокрутки, кліки та більше. Це створює ID вимірювання, що пов'язує сайт з GA4, увімкнувши вбудовані контролі для збору даних. Якщо ви також ведете мобільний додаток, додайте окремий потік додатка, щоб тримати дані додатка окремими, але пов'язаними в одній властивості.
Встановіть фрагмент або використовуйте Tag Manager: GA4 пропонує вбудований фрагмент та інтеграції GTM. Вставте фрагмент у заголовок сайту або розгорніть через Tag Manager. Фрагмент виглядає так: gtag('config', 'G-XXXXXXXXXX'); Замініть заповнювач на ваш фактичний ID вимірювання. Після цього відвідайте ваш сайт, щоб перевірити, що дані надходять у звіти Real-time.
Перевірте потік даних та створіть сегменти аудиторії: використовуйте звіти Real-time, щоб підтвердити, що події спрацьовують, і дані надходять до вашої властивості. Використовуйте змінні для захоплення конкретних параметрів подій та адаптуйте інсайти для звітності. Створюйте сегменти аудиторії за поведінкою, пристроєм або розташуванням, щоб підтримувати цільове тестування та персоналізовані повідомлення. Обсяг вашого потоку даних визначає, які звіти відображають події, які ви відстежуєте.
Інтеграції та постійна оптимізація: пов'яжіть вашу властивість GA4 з Google Ads, Search Console та іншими платформами, щоб розширити інсайти. Для кліків застосовуйте кастомні класи та відстежуйте їх з конвенцією link_classes, щоб збагачувати дані залученості. Це підтримує багато рекомендованих дашбордів та легке поширення з клієнтами. Після завершення проведіть швидкий аудит та повідомте стейкхолдерів, що змінилося, використовуючи основні звіти, щоб показати продуктивність по каналах та пристроях.
Встановіть Google Tag Manager на вашому сайті
Встановіть контейнер GTM та розмістіть блоки коду, як описано у вашій документації. Двочастинний фрагмент завантажується у вікні та увімкнює заходи, як кліки та конверсії, по секціях вашого сайту. Скопіюйте скрипт head та noscript iframe: вставте скрипт head негайно після відкривального тегу <head>, та розмістіть noscript iframe у body відразу після відкривального тегу <body>, щоб тримати продуктивність стабільною на пристроях.
Налаштуйте теги, тригери та змінні в GTM. Це надає централізований підхід для пов'язування вашого сайту з інструментами вимірювання. Стандартна конфігурація охоплює GA4 та Google Ads; додавання подій для етапів продажів, подання форм та взаємодій з продуктами є простим. Використовуйте UI, щоб додати елемент, обрати тип тегу, вибрати тригер та зберегти. Ви можете перемикатися між Test та Live, щоб порівнювати результати та забезпечити захоплення правильних даних по пристроях.
Щоб перевірити налаштування та ловити проблеми рано, використовуйте режим Preview (налагодження). Панель Preview показує, які теги спрацьовують і коли. Використовуйте поле пошуку, щоб знайти конкретні функції, та перевірте записи window.dataLayer, коли ви переходите по сторінках. Стрілка в панелі дозволяє розширити деталі для кожного тегу. На відміну від ручного тегування, цей метод тримає вашу документацію охайною та зменшує дублювання для менеджерів, що працюють над кампаніями.
| Крок | Дія | Примітки |
|---|---|---|
| 1 | Створіть акаунт Google Tag Manager та контейнер для вашого сайту | Використовуйте один контейнер на домен; стандартне найменування допомагає поширення по командах |
| 2 | Встановіть фрагмент GTM | Розмістіть скрипт head у <head> та noscript iframe у <body> після відкривального тегу |
| 3 | Додайте тег GA4 та необхідні тригери | Пов'яжіть з потоками даних GA4; встановіть назви подій, як view_item, add_to_cart |
| 4 | Preview та налагодження | Клацніть Preview, переходьте по сторінках, спостерігайте спрацьовування та dataLayer, шукайте функції |
| 5 | Опублікуйте та моніторте | Випустіть зміни, моніторте real-time та конверсії, перегляньте конфігурацію після змін |
Налаштуйте тег конфігурації GA4 у GTM
Створіть тег Конфігурація GA4 у GTM за допомогою вашого ID вимірювання GA4 та увімкніть його для спрацьовування на All Pages. Це створює солідну базу даних для веб та додатків, забезпечуючи, що page_view та сигнали сесії захоплюються послідовно.
-
Конфігурація тегу: У GTM клацніть Tag > New > Tag Configuration > Google Analytics: GA4 Configuration. Введіть ID вимірювання (G-XXXXXXXXXX) та підтвердьте, що назва властивості GA4 відповідає вашій властивості GA4. Це тримає дані узгодженими по продуктах та додатках.
-
Поля для встановлення: Залиште основні поля за замовчуванням. Якщо потрібно передати додатковий контекст, додайте поля, як page_title та page_path. Для відстежування file_download ви можете додати параметр з назвою file_download з відповідним значенням, але це опціонально для базового налаштування.
-
Надсилання Page View: Увімкніть Send Page View on load, щоб забезпечити, що початковий сигнал сторінки надсилається автоматично з кожним завантаженням сторінки. Це плюс зменшує потребу в окремих подіях для захоплення перших вражень сторінки.
-
Тригер: Встановіть тег для спрацьовування на All Pages. Для сайтів з динамічним маршрутизацією розгляньте невеликий додатковий тригер для змін маршруту, щоб ловити оновлення односторінкових додатків.
-
Контроль дублів: Якщо ви замінили старший тег GA, не залишайте старий увімкненим. Видаліть дублі негайно, щоб уникнути спотворених метрик та подвійного підрахунку.
-
Найменування та іконка: Назвіть тег чітко, наприклад GA4 Configuration - Main, та покладайтеся на іконку, щоб швидко ідентифікувати його в списку. Це допомагає швидкому пошуку та легкій навігації для приєднуючихся членів команди, що працюють над аналітикою.
-
Тестування: Використовуйте режим Preview та перевірте GA4 DebugView, щоб підтвердити, що page_view спрацьовує на кількох сторінках. Якщо з'являється проблема, двічі перевірте ID вимірювання та потік даних, потім скорегуйте та пере-тестуйте.
Підсумок: Добре налаштований тег Конфігурація GA4 на All Pages надає основу для точних метрик по сайтах та додатках. Після цього ви можете додати теги подій GA4 для конкретних дій, як інтерактивні кліки продуктів або завантаження файлів, щоб збагачувати ваші дані без торкання основної конфігурації. Ставтеся до цього тегу як до бази, потім розширюйте додатковим відстеженням подій за потреби. Цей підхід тримає речі легкими та масштабованими, з чітким шляхом до майбутніх покращень, як події пошуку або додаткові функції.
Тестуйте та валідуйте відстеження з DebugView та звітами Real-Time

Увімкніть DebugView та звіти Real-Time, щоб перевірити відстеження за секунду та уникнути прогалин. Цей підхід тримає ваше вимірювання видимим для вашого менеджменту та стейкхолдерів.
Спочатку підтвердьте, що тег GA4 встановлено на всіх сторінках та ID вимірювання правильний. Потім увімкніть режим налагодження, додавши цей фрагмент: gtag('config', 'G-XXXXXXXXXX', { 'debug_mode': true }); або використовуйте розширення GA Debugger. Цей крок робить вхідні хіти легкими для інспекції.
Відкрийте DebugView у вашій властивості GA4 та виконуйте дії, такі як перехід на сторінку, клік на CTA або подання форми. DebugView перелічує хіти з міткою часу та показує поля для event_name та event_params; ви побачите іконку поруч з кожним рядком, що вказує тип хіта.
Перемкніться на звіти Real-Time: Real-time > Live reports; спостерігайте, як ті самі події з'являються, перевірте підрахунки та перевірте час проти вашого очікуваного потоку. Валідуйте ключові параметри, як page_location, page_title та будь-які кастомні виміри, щоб забезпечити, що значення полів відповідають визначенням.
Створіть список визначень, що мапує назви подій до ваших бізнес-действий, потім порівняйте проти звітів, щоб підтвердити, що відстеження відповідає вашому плану. Зазначте будь-який елемент, де значення є none, та скорегуйте зіставлення події або назви параметрів відповідно.
Налагодження: якщо подія не з'являється, перевірте, що тег спрацьовує на дію, перегляньте будь-які блокери, що можуть приховати хіт, та підтвердьте, що ID вимірювання встановлено на сторінці. Тримайте в умі запити конфіденційності та налаштування згоди, оскільки вони можуть призупинити збір даних.
Використовуйте цей метод, щоб підтримувати глобальну видимість по властивостях та дашбордам реклами; коли зміна впроваджується, ви побачите її вплив у реальному часі, без здогадок. Таким чином, ви отримуєте впевненість, що ваше налаштування надає надійні дані для рішень.
Швидкі поради: тримайте валідування сфокусованим та дієвим, проводьте другий прохід після оновлень та підтримуйте короткий список очікуваних значень полів, щоб ви могли поділитися знахідками з командою, навіть якщо змін не відбулося в момент. Пам'ятайте захищати конфіденційність користувачів та уникати зберігання особистих даних у полях подій.
Ready to leverage AI for your business?
Book a free strategy call — no strings attached.


